Druid spellbooks sucks big time. It's got some of the most mediocre spells. Its CC spells require concentration but are not as good as Hypnotic Pattern or Hunger of Hakkar, its damage spells are pretty terrible, no access to chain lightning and the damage scaling of the other spells drops off a cliff and they don't get any passives or mechanics to boost spell damage or utility like wizard/sorc/warlock do (though warlock is pretty bad as well as a pure spellcaster), the druid healing spells are garbage since you need cleric life domain to make healing spells efficient for spell slot use, otherwise throwing health potions is immensely more effective, and a cleric channel divinity aoe heal is healing for 40+ HP on 2 charges per short rest while a druid lv5 mass cure wound is healing 17-20 HP, pretty terrible as by that point most HP pools are 70-80+ and a single enemy attack is outdamaging that heal.
They need to remove concentration from a lot of druid ground hazard and vine spells to make them an effective CC multiplier class and land druids should get access to chain lightning and improved cantrip damage while spore druids should get Dethrone and have their spore damage improved. Both moon and spore druid should get extra melee attacks on their humanoid forms.
If they reasoned that caster druids would be mediocre because the forms would carry the day as the main class mechanic, they majorly screwed up, as there are like 3 whole items in the entire game that work with wildshapes (2 of them gated to act 3), many feats don't, and many elixirs and potions don't really affect wildshape performance outside potion of speed, and you can't even use consumables while wildshaped or benefit from venoms/oils. The wildshapes don't scale well at all and neither does their spellbook and humanoid form.
